Understanding Provably Fair Gaming
A cornerstone of platforms like rainbet is the concept of "provably fair" gaming. Traditional online casinos rely on third-party auditing to ensure the randomness and fairness of their games. However, this system can be opaque, leaving players with limited ability to independently verify the results. Provably fair gaming, on the other hand, utilizes cryptographic algorithms to allow players to confirm that each game outcome is truly random and hasn't been manipulated by the operator. This transparency builds trust and significantly increases player confidence. The core principle involves a combination of client-seed, server-seed, and a nonce, which are used to generate the game result. Players can verify the integrity of the process by independently calculating the outcome using these seeds.
How Cryptographic Seeds Work
The process begins with the server generating a random seed, which is hashed and publicly displayed before the game begins. This pre-commitment ensures that the server cannot alter the seed after seeing the player’s bet. The player then provides their own seed, often referred to as a client seed. These two seeds, along with a nonce (a unique number specific to each game round), are fed into a cryptographic hash function. The resulting hash determines the outcome of the game. Players can access the server seed and nonce after the game and independently verify the outcome, confirming the fairness of the result. This entire process is designed to be mathematically verifiable, offering a level of trust unattainable in traditional online casinos.
| Server Seed | A random value generated by the platform before each game. |
| Client Seed | A value provided by the player to influence the outcome. |
| Nonce | A unique number specific to each game round. |
| Hash Function | A cryptographic algorithm that transforms the seeds and nonce into a game result. |

Security Measures and Risk Mitigation
Security is paramount when dealing with online gaming and cryptocurrency. Platforms inspired by rainbet typically employ a multi-layered security approach to protect user funds and data. This includes measures such as two-factor authentication (2FA), encryption of sensitive data, and regular security audits. Smart contracts, which are self-executing agreements written into code, are often used to automate game logic and ensure fairness. These contracts are immutable, meaning they cannot be altered once deployed, further enhancing security and transparency. However, it's crucial to remember that smart contracts are not foolproof and can be vulnerable to exploits if not properly coded and audited. Users should always exercise caution and be aware of the risks associated with smart contract interactions.
Understanding Smart Contract Audits
Smart contract audits are independent reviews conducted by security experts to identify potential vulnerabilities in the code. These audits help to ensure that the contract functions as intended and does not contain any hidden flaws that could be exploited by malicious actors. A thorough audit should cover various aspects of the contract, including its logic, security, and documentation. While an audit doesn’t guarantee complete security, it significantly reduces the risk of vulnerabilities. Players should look for platforms that have undergone reputable third-party audits and actively address any identified issues. Transparency regarding audit reports is a positive sign of a platform’s commitment to security.
